Lizzie lives in Essex, with her gorgeous husband, two bouncy children and a very unusual dog. In between the school run and baking cakes, (or burning them!) she sits in her rooftop studio daydreaming about gaps in the market and how she can fill them. Babe Driven is her first novel.
Lizzie is an enthusiastic inventor, businesswoman and artist. She founded her first company at the age of 17 and has been creating products and driving her family mad ever since.
Lizzie has appeared on Sky News, ITV Lunchtime news, This morning, The Big Breakfast and the BBC’S worldwide radio service, along with many local radio stations, for becoming one of Fair Play London’s female innovators.
Lizzie wrote Babe Driven during a time when her youngest daughter was unwell, to help her stay awake at night so that she could hear her daughter’s breathing. Chocolate and coffee had failed to work, so she begun to weave a story of intrigue and sunshine to help her stay alert and to stop her falling asleep.
About Lizzie’s Book:
Babe Driven: Driving straight out of trouble and into paradise!
Harriet’s crazily successful business idea is under serious threat, and the danger seems to be coming
from inside her own family. She whisks her sister and her friends away to an exotic location to try
and work out whose side they are on. It’s time to start damage limitation.
Harriet will have to choose between family and friends, business or pleasure. For someone who stays
out of the limelight, even though her new company is the hottest ticket in town, she’s going to have
to avoid the front pages of every newspaper if she wants to survive the ride!
